Essential Film scoring Equipment

Every composer has unique needs, but certain tools form the backbone ⁤of effective film scoring. below is a list of essential equipment you should consider:

1. Digital Audio Workstation (DAW)

Your DAW ⁣serves ⁢as the foundation for your film scoring process. Popular options include:

  • Logic Pro X: Preferred by manny film‍ composers‍ for its vast sound library.
  • Pro ⁤Tools: The industry standard for audio editing ​and mixing.
  • Ableton Live: Great for creating loops and beats on the fly.

2. MIDI Controllers

MIDI controllers help you produce and manipulate sound samples. Some​ options include:

  • Akai⁤ MPK Mini: compact and versatile, ‍perfect for beginners.
  • Native⁣ Instruments‌ Komplete Kontrol: Integrates well with many ‍plugins.
  • Novation Launchkey: User-friendly and great⁢ for live performances.

3. sample Libraries

Having a rich sample library is key to achieving realism in your scoring. Consider⁣ these popular libraries:

Sample Library Key ‍Features Price Range
Spitfire ⁢Audio high-quality orchestral samples $$$
EastWest Sounds Wide variety of ‌genres $$
Vienna Symphonic Library detailed orchestral instruments $$$$

4. Audio Interface

Your audio ⁤interface bridges the gap between your computer and external audio sources. Recommendations‍ include:

  • Focusrite ​Scarlett: Known ⁢for its​ quality and affordability.
  • Universal ​Audio Apollo: Offers superior sound quality⁣ with ⁢built-in plugins.
  • presonus AudioBox: Great for home studios and‍ mobile setups.

5. Studio ‍Monitors & Headphones

To ⁣accurately hear your mixes, ⁤invest in good studio⁢ monitors and headphones. Options ⁣to⁣ consider:

  • yamaha HS‍ Series: ‍Great for clear⁢ sound reproduction.
  • KRK‌ Rokit: Popular among many ‍genres for their punchy sound.
  • Beyerdynamic DT⁢ 990 Pro: Agreeable and precise‍ headphones.

Case Study: The Impact of Scoring Equipment

Consider the case of composer John ‌Williams.⁢ Known for ‌his⁢ work⁢ on iconic films like “Star Wars” and “Indiana Jones”,⁢ Williams uses a combination of‌ live orchestras along with cutting-edge digital tools to bring his scores ‍to ​life. His ‍mastery of both traditional and‌ modern⁢ techniques highlights the importance of versatility in ⁤film scoring equipment.
